Arm & Hammer Foot Wipes: Sweet for Your Feet

Package containing Arm & Hammer Foot Wipes. White package with orange and blue highlights.

I never really think about whether or not my feet are clean, but I am aware that they need some love. I’ve spent most of my summer at the lake, with my feet crammed into wet water shoes. So I was eager to test Arm & Hammer’s “Cleansing and Refreshing” Foot Wipes.

The wipes come in a 30-wipe back that has a resealable opening, just like other types of wipes. The packet is about five inches wide, seven inches tall, and maybe half an inch thick; it fits into into my purse, daypack, and swim bag.

Once I figured out how to remove just one wipe (as opposed to a clump of three wipes stuck together), I enjoyed using the Arm & Hammer’s Foot Wipes. They are damp enough that I can clean both of my feet. They do feel refreshing when my feet are hot, dirty, sticky, or just tired (btw, my feet never smell, but if that is a problem for you, maybe these wipes could help!).

I used the Foot Wipes daily when I was on a lake vacation a few weeks ago. My feet were dry and sandy all the time. Using the wipes meant I could get my feet clean and enough the comfort of sand-free feet when I slept. Added bonus: fewer showers.

The wipes contain aloe, tea tree oil, and other plant extracts. Arm & Hammer says they wipes have a “fresh scent.” I would have to agree with that description. I am not usually a fan of personal products because I’m allergic to all the chemicals they contain, but didn’t have any trouble with these wipes.

Bottom Line

It’s nice to have a way to quickly freshen up my feet, especially when trying to keep sand out of my hosts’s beach house.
